Factors Affecting Cost
- Soil Type: The type of soil in Chattanooga can range from loose sand to dense clay, impacting the difficulty and cost of excavation.
- Depth and Width of the Ditch: Deeper and wider ditches require more labor and equipment, increasing the overall cost.
- Accessibility of the Site: Sites that are difficult to access may require specialized equipment or additional labor, raising costs.
- Presence of Obstacles: Rocks, roots, and existing structures can complicate excavation, leading to higher expenses.
- Permits and Regulations: Local regulations and the need for permits can add to the cost of the project.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task Description | Average Cost (Chattanooga, TN) |
---|---|
Basic Ditch Excavation (per linear foot) | $10 - $20 |
Deep Ditch Excavation (over 4 feet deep) | $20 - $35 |
Rock Removal and Excavation | $30 - $50 per cubic yard |
Utility Line Installation | $15 - $25 per linear foot |
Drainage System Installation | $20 - $40 per linear foot |
Permitting and Inspection Fees | $100 - $500 per project |
